Presentations

Prepare:
  • Know what you’re talking about 
  • Plan to a story you want to tell and break down slides to remind yourself
  • Use imagery to enhance what you’re saying and reinforce points you’re covering 
  • Limit text as lots of text takes away from what your saying 



Relax:
  • Fight or flight reaction to facing crowds
  • Easiest way to relax is to prepare and rehearse so you are fully conversant with what your talking about 
  • Keep it simple


Speak Clearly:
Take your time and try not to read from notes

Introduce yourself, simply tell people who you are 

Smile!

Tell them what they're going to see:
set out what you want to cover during the presentation 

Make eye contact, pause and relax and remember to smile 

Take your time, theres no need to rush

Pauses:
a few pauses will relax you and helps people catch up and consider potential questions 

Tell it a story: 
  • Beginning
  • Middle 
  • End 


Consider adding a video:
  • it will allow for a break and pause 
  • lift a presentation, make it more interesting 


If you use bullet points:
think about build ups so there not read all at once, this can also be applied to images 

Checklist:
  • why am I doing it 
  • what am I trying to get over 
  • what do I need to show 
  • get a rough draft together, time it out and refine 
  • Check quality of images 


Spell check if using words
Final file preparation 

Hardware:
  • Check files on more than one computer 
  • Make sure the its saved in the correct format 
  • Save onto one or two memory sticks 
  • Save as a pdf 
  • Test on projectors 


Consider:
Printing presentation, bind with a nice cover and leave so it can be reviewed
